Pakistan Continues To Prioritize Girls’ Education: Aseefa Bhutto

Doha: First Lady Aseefa Bhutto Zardari emphasized Pakistan’s ongoing commitment to prioritizing girls’ education, skills development, economic inclusion, and digital empowerment. She made these remarks during the Third Edition of the Princess Sabeeka Bint Ibrahim Al Khalifa Global Award for Women’s Empowerment, held at the Qatar National Convention Centre today.

Turkish Interior Minister Visits Pakistan Monument

Islamabad: A smartly turned-out contingent of Islamabad Police presented a guard of honour to the visiting Turkish Interior Minister. Ali Yerlikaya paid homage at the Martyrs’ Monument, laid a floral wreath, and offered Fateha (prayers) for the martyrs. CM Punjab Encourages Chinese Investments in Provincial Sectors

Lahore: A delegation of prominent Chinese investors met with Chief Minister Punjab Maryam Nawaz Sharif in Lahore today. During the meeting, the Chinese investors showed a strong interest in investing in multiple sectors of Punjab. According to Radio Pakistan, Chief Minister Maryam Nawaz Sharif highlighted Punjab’s significant potential for investment.
